Note(s) : Hailed as groundbreaking upon its original release, the Oscar-winning film Boys Don't
Cry offered the first mainstream access to transmasculine embodiment in North America,
one that many simultaneously celebrated and rejected. More than two decades after
its original release, the film has become a lightning rod for contemporary debates
about the representation of trans lives and deaths on screen. Representational possibilities
for trans people have changed dramatically since 1999. Morgan Page and Chase Joynt
approach the accumulated tension with a spirit of curiosity about the limits of these
historical returns. They argue that new visibilities of transness on screen require
us to re-engage earlier portrayals: Boys Don't Cry is central to conversations about
casting, violence against gender non-conforming people, and the borders between butch
and trans identities. Acknowledging a younger generation of queer and trans people
who are straining against the images foisted upon them, including this film's egregious
violence, and an older cohort for whom it remains a formative, if complicated, touchstone,
Joynt and Page revisit the original contexts of production and distribution to unsettle
the overdetermined ways the work has been understood and interpreted. Boys Don't Cry
ultimately relocates the film in a way that attends to the story's violence and values,
both on and off screen.
